      PENN Partners With Light & Wonder For Branded Live Dealer Games In Michigan

      The newly announced partnership marks some firsts for both companies

      PENN Entertainment has announced a strategic partnership with Light & Wonder to launch branded live dealer studio games in Michigan. The exclusive Hollywood Casino at Greektown-branded live dealer tables are now available through PENN’s Hollywood Casino product.

      The selection of new titles introduced includes Hollywood Casino at Greektown-branded blackjack tables, which have been specifically designed for the Michigan market. In addition to the branded blackjack tables, PENN Entertainment has launched a new live dealer version of Lucky Cat Baccarat, a popular original title developed by Penn Game Studios (PGS), the company’s in-house game development team.

      This initiative, according to the press release, represents the first time that Light & Wonder Live has created bespoke live dealer tables using an operator’s brand in Michigan. It is also the first instance of PENN launching online casino games branded with a local casino.

      For PENN Entertainment, the launch of branded live dealer games is a strategic move that aligns with its broader goals of expanding its digital footprint and enhancing player engagement. The use of local property branding, such as the Hollywood Casino at Greektown tables, adds an extra layer of personalization that is likely to resonate with players who have a connection to the physical casino.

      Expanding the game selection with Light & Wonder

      Beyond the live dealer games, PENN Entertainment has also expanded its offering by adding Light & Wonder casino games to Hollywood Casino in Michigan and theScore Bet Sportsbook & Casino in Ontario, Canada. This expansion is part of PENN’s broader strategy to leverage its partnerships and in-house capabilities to deliver a diverse gaming experience across its platforms.

      The introduction of branded live dealer games comes at a time when the popularity of such online casino games is surging. These games combine the convenience of online gaming with some of the interactive and social aspects of playing in a physical casino, offering players the best of both worlds.

      The live dealer format typically involves a real-life dealer who is streamed to the player’s device in real time, facilitating games such as blackjack, roulette, and baccarat.

      Live dealer games driving iGaming growth

      According to industry data, the live dealer market has been one of the fastest-growing segments in online gaming. A report by Grand View Research projected that the global online gambling market size would reach $153 billion by 2030, with the live dealer segment playing a significant role in this growth.

      In the U.S., the popularity of live dealer games has been bolstered by the (slowly) increasing legalization of online gambling in various states. Players are drawn to the authenticity and transparency of live dealer games, as the use of real dealers and physical cards or wheels adds a level of trust that is sometimes lacking in purely digital games.

      Moreover, the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of online gaming, as many players sought alternatives to visiting physical casinos. The rise of live dealer games provided a compelling option for players looking to replicate the social aspects of casino gaming while adhering to social distancing guidelines. Even as physical casinos have reopened, the demand for live dealer games has remained strong, indicating a lasting shift in player preferences.
